As VFLover09 stated in her post, time traveling can have serious consequences for your game (even when unintentional!) There's more information about that here. The time change to your mac could very well be what is causing the delayed proposals.

Since the game has a real-time engine, time changes of any sort can mess with the internal timing. You'll find a bit more detailed explanation in the link above, along with a few solutions. smile

It has been my observation that after the first 2 proposals are rejected, my peeps seem to get additional proposals at the rate of about 1 proposal per 24 hours of game running. Marie was 26 when she took over the house and rejected at least 5 men. I finally decided to marry her off at the age of 42 so that she would be young enough to produce children since no abandoned children had shown up at her door.

Even if the person proposing marriage doesn't want children, they can still have them. Go ahead and marry your woman to the next gentleman who comes knocking and perhaps there will be enough time to make a baby. An adoption event can still happen as well. Just know that your game will not end after your female passes away because there is someone to inherit the house, the female who is now 15. smile
